Let's simplify the following expression:

[tex]\text{ (8x}^2-9y^2-4x)+(x^2-3y^2-7x)[/tex]

We get,

[tex]\text{ (8x}^2-9y^2-4x)+(x^2-3y^2-7x)[/tex][tex]\text{ 8x}^2-9y^2-4x+x^2-3y^2-7x[/tex]

Let's put like terms beside each other and proceed with the operation:

[tex]\text{ 8x}^2-9y^2-4x+x^2-3y^2-7x[/tex][tex]\text{ 8x}^2+x^2-9y^2-3y^2-7x-4x[/tex][tex]\text{ (8x}^2+x^2)+(-9y^2-3y^2)+(-7x-4x)[/tex][tex]\text{ (9x}^2^{})+(-12y^2)+(-11x)[/tex][tex]\text{ 9x}^2-12y^2-11x[/tex]

Therefore, the sum of the given polynomials (8x^2-9y^2-4x)+(x^2-3y^2–7x) is 9x^2 - 12y^2 - 11x.
